🪖 Bornholm island: NATO’s Baltic bridgehead for aggression against Russia

Copenhagen is using the old ‘Russian threat’ excuse to justify the militarization of its easternmost island, but NATO operational planning and drills reveal otherwise.

📍Where is Bornholm?

Situated about 140 km southeast of Copenhagen in waters between Sweden, Poland and Germany, the 588 km2 island has been a strategic stronghold since medieval times, used by Vikings, Scandinavian kings, Napoleon and the Nazis for both defensive and offensive operations.

In 2022, NATO announced plans to turn the Baltic Sea into a ‘NATO lake’. Bornholm would play a key role in this calculus.

🔊 Breaking old agreements

Freed from the Nazis by the Red Army in WWII, Bornholm was returned to Denmark by Moscow on the understanding that foreign troops would never again be stationed there. Denmark reneged in 2022, okaying large-scale NATO drills on and around the island.

Drills have included deployments of US HIMARS MLRS (300 km max range) and Typhon missile system components (2,500 km range). The Typhon TEL can fire SM-6 and Tomahawk missiles, whose payload, notably, can include nuclear warheads.

🪖 Military infrastructure buildup

🔸 construction of a 85m spy tower in Ostermarie (2017)

🔸 inclusion in NATO’s Baltic “island chain” strategy alongside Gotland and Aland (2023)

🔸 plans to add 5k troops to the local garrison (2025)

⚔️ Air and naval power projection

Bornholm’s Ronne Airport has a military apron, and has been used in drills by Finnish F-18 jets (2024). USAF strategic bombers flying toward Russian cities have hidden in the island’s airspace to avoid interception by Russian jets.

Ronne’s seaport has undergone expansions (2023) to accommodate large ships, including military and support vessels.

🚨🤔 USA TO TAKE CONTROL OF STRATEGIC CORRIDOR IN SOUTH CAUCASUS?

US Ambassador to Turkiye Tom Barrack dropped a bombshell: Washington is ready to manage the Zangezur Corridor, the route between mainland Azerbaijan and its Nakhchivan exclave — running through Armenia’s region.

The proposal? A 100-YEAR LEASE to a private American operator who would act as a “neutral guarantor”, ensuring equal access for both Armenia and Azerbaijan.

According to Barrack, the idea originally came from Turkiye and has reportedly received preliminary approval from both Yerevan and Baku.
